Transaction 7af8c924f569d121d25215dd0f9713967b829e276b965be2a54d13365798fd64
1 Input
1 Output
-
7af8c924f569d121d25215dd0f9713967b829e276b965be2a54d13365798fd64:0
- value
- 3383509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 294ff2007a3e609abf593230a8a8806bed14c6df OP_EQUAL
- address
- 35TTQ7ACg41ajqDppQLcxY96QaYLqG37rD